The Scotsman is embarking on an 11-day Australian tour in January and February, 2015, visiting cities around the country.
The first time Connolly had Aussies laughing with his stand-up was away back in 1978 and has visited frequently ever since.
Connolly's High Horse tour promises to entertain audiences with all the latest funny tales that have happened since his last trip here.
It is a triumphant return to the stage for the legendary comedian and actor, who last year underwent surgery for early stage prostate cancer and was also diagnosed with Parkinson's disease.
Connolly will appear on February 22, 2015 at Newcastle Entertainment Centre, Newcastle.
